What is the 1997 Vermont Income Tax Extension Application?

The 1997 Vermont Income Tax Extension Application, known as Form IN-151, is a vital document for Vermont residents seeking to postpone the filing of their state income tax returns. Taxpayers may find themselves in need of this application to gain additional time to prepare their returns for the 1997 tax year. By applying for the extension, individuals ensure they adhere to the legal requirements set forth by the Vermont tax authority.
This application serves as an official request for an extension, specifically designed for residents of Vermont. It is pivotal for taxpayers who may be experiencing unexpected circumstances that prevent timely filing.

Purpose and Benefits of the 1997 Vermont Income Tax Extension Application

The primary benefit of filing the 1997 Vermont Income Tax Extension Application is that it grants taxpayers additional time for filing their state income tax returns. By submitting this form, individuals can avoid immediate penalties associated with late filings. However, it is essential to note that while the extension postpones the filing deadline, it does not delay the payment of taxes owed.

Any Vermont resident who needs more time to file their 1997 Individual Income Tax Return can use this application to request an extension.
The extension application should be submitted by the original filing deadline for the 1997 tax return to avoid penalties and interest on unpaid taxes.
You can submit your completed 1997 Vermont Income Tax Extension Application by mail to the address specified on the form or follow the e-filing instructions if applicable.
Typically, you do not need to attach documents with your extension application, but ensuring your tax liability calculations are clear and accurate is crucial.
Ensure that all personal and financial information is accurate, avoid leaving fields blank, and double-check for any spelling errors in your name or address.
Processing times may vary, but you should expect a confirmation of your extension request shortly after submission, usually within a few weeks.
Yes, while an extension allows for more time to file, it does not extend the deadline to pay any taxes due. Penalties and interest may apply to any unpaid tax balances.
